Hi guys. I'm getting my brother a starter bow for his birthday.
From how he shoots my bow, looks like he'll end up with a longer draw than me.
I'm figuring he'll be shootin 54@30.5 from the bow I'm lookin at. Recurve with dacron off the shelf.
So what do ya think---2020 or 2117?
Thanks
PS- with 125gr BH or 150 if need be.

52 bow

I shoot 2018 and 2020's from my 67-69lb. bows at 31".Great flying heavy shafts.You might try 2016-18's first but try what you have- they may work perfect!

He should be able to shoot either one.  They only spine out on the charts 3 pounds different.  They should fly almost identical if they are cut the same length and have the same weight up front.  At least that is what I have found with mine, I shoot both.
